Types of Vehicle Diagnostics

Vehicle diagnostics can be used to determine the cause of a variety of issues with vehicles. There are various types of diagnostic tools, and the service technician will use the correct one for the situation and the present technical condition. These tools include OBD-II and CANBUS. The most appropriate tool for the job can help the technician diagnose the problem and make the repairs required.

OBD-II

OBD-II vehicle diagnostics are performed using sensors that detect problems with vehicles. These sensors transmit abnormal information to the vehicle's engine controller unit (ECU) and it stores it as a Diagnostic Trouble Code. The code is a sequence of letters and numbers that identify the type and the root of the issue. OBD-II codes can be used to identify all parts of a vehicle , including the chassis, powertrain and the network.

Different tools are available to perform OBD-II vehicle diagnostics. These tools vary from simple tools for consumers to sophisticated OEM dealership tools and vehicle electronic telematics systems. The most basic tools comprise hand-held scan tools and fault code readers. But, there are sophisticated and rugged devices available in the market.

A scan tool reads the diagnostic trouble codes from a vehicle's computer system. It can also read the vehicle's VIN. OBD-II scanners also come with a feature which allows them to read codes from any protocol. The data can be read and interpreted by a mechanic, and they can give you the necessary details about the issue with your vehicle.

OBD-II vehicle diagnostics can help you save money on repairs and improve the performance of your vehicle. They also provide details about the health of key engine components and emission control. This information is helpful for diagnosing problems quickly and easily.

CANBUS

A scanner tool can be used to look over the entire system vehicles that are CANBUS compliant. It will show which modules need to be on and which ones are off. This could indicate a problem with the wiring or communication.

CAN bus problems can present a variety of symptoms, including partial or total loss of vehicle functionality. These problems usually result in an audible or a visual warning for the driver of the vehicle. Software problems could also be a possible cause. A CAN bus issue could also cause a malfunctioning charging system, low battery voltage, or improper connections.

A low resistance reading on a CAN connector is indicative of a malfunctioning device, or a defective wiring harness. Some CAN devices may contain an internal termination resistor that turns on and off as the device starts up. The service information provided by the manufacturer will include the internal termination resistors used for the specific CAN device.


The CAN bus protocol is a message-based protocol developed to enable communication between automobile components. Multiplex electrical wiring can be utilized to save copper while allowing communication between vehicles. Each device transmits information in a frame that is received by all devices connected to the network.

Check engine light

The Check engine light on your car could be a sign of a serious issue. You must immediately check your car when you see an orange or red light. The faster you get it fixed, the less costly it will cost. There are other symptoms such as engine noises or unusual engine sounds.

The Check Engine Light, regardless of the cause is designed to alert you about a problem with your vehicle. The Check Engine Light is an orange, engine-shaped symbol that is found in the instrument cluster. car diagnostic check is activated when the car's onboard computer detects the problem. The indicator can be activated by a range of issues however, sometimes it's as simple as a gas cap that isn't tight enough or a defective spark plug.

Another reason for a Check Engine Light is a issue with the exhaust system. An exhaust gas recirculation valve (EGR) can trigger this light to illuminate. These valves do not require regular maintenance , but they could become carbon-clogged and need to be replaced. EGR valves that aren't functioning properly can result in higher levels of emissions. After you have addressed the issue the car will then switch off the light. However, if your car's CEL has been on for more than three days, you may need to examine the issue once more or try manually setting the light.

A diagnostic scan will reveal issues that cause your Check Engine Light to turn on. In some instances just a quick scan using an easy scan tool can identify the issue. For more complicated issues, you'll need to use professional scanners.

Trouble codes

DTCs (diagnostic trouble codes) are codes that can be used to find out the source of problems with your vehicle. They range in length between one and five characters, and can be used to represent anything from warning lights to malfunctioning engine. These codes are used to solve issues and pinpoint where they are occurring.

Although DTCs are used to diagnose car problems but not all are serious. Sometimes, trouble codes indicate that the sensor circuit is out of range or that there is an issue with the emissions control system. Once you have identified the problem it is time to fix it. It is essential to know the location where trouble codes are stored in your vehicle. DTCs are usually stored in the Engine Control Module or Powertrain Control Module.

Diagnostic trouble codes are also important in determining the type of problem is causing the issue. They can aid a mechanic to identify the cause of problems and determine what repairs are necessary. For instance, the check engine light might indicate a problem with your circuit that controls the fuel level. It could also indicate a malfunction in the emissions idle control system. In other instances, the light could be indicative of something more serious, like a loose gas caps.

Some of these codes may be serious and require immediate repair. It is crucial to know which DTC is the most serious and urgently repair when you have more that one.

Checking fuel supply

The process of diagnosing your vehicle are often complicated by the importance of fuel pressure and volume. A malfunctioning fuel pump could create diagnostic trouble codes on the computer of your vehicle. These codes can be read using codes readers or a scan tool. Many auto parts stores offer code reading services at no cost. You can also purchase inexpensive code reading devices for smartphones. Once you've figured out what to look for, you can start taking a look at the pressure inside your fuel system.

Checking the fuel supply is a step by step process. It's fairly easy to carry out. The first step for checking the fuel system is to listen for a humming sound. It should last around 2 seconds before stopping. If you hear a sound, it's likely that the electrical circuit inside your fuel pump is operating well. If not, you'll need to perform additional diagnostic tests.

You should also examine the fuel pressure as well as the MAF sensor for leaks in fuel. A damaged MAF sensor could be the culprit of the P0171/P0174 codes. If you're not certain which part you should replace, consult a volumetric efficiency calculator or chart to determine which one you should replace.

To ensure that your vehicle is in good health It is vital to test the fuel pressure. If your vehicle is not running properly, even if the pressure is high, it will experience difficulty getting started. A low flow of fuel can indicate poor pressure readings on the voltmeter. You can test the ampage and voltage of the injector's pulses using a scope and an amp clamp.

Checking the air filter

Dirty air filters can cause various issues within your vehicle, including an acceleration that jolts, fuel that isn't burned and mini explosions. You can detect problems early by checking your air filter. To begin, begin by removing any fasteners that hold the air intake box together. These fasteners may be clips, screws or even hex nuts. Once the fasteners have been removed you can take the air filter out.

Make sure the filter is clean and seated properly. This will enable the filter to perform its functions effectively. The engine might not function properly if it has a filter that is dirty. It may also not provide precise readings. The air filter is usually located near the engine or in front of the vehicle.

A blocked air filter may also trigger the check engine light to turn on. This indicator could also signal the presence of a more serious issue. A clogged air filter restricts the flow of air into the engine, which can cause excessive fuel being burned. Carbon deposits that are excessive can cause the check engine light. A knowledgeable mechanic will be able identify the reason for the check engine light.

The air filter is a vital element in the engine of a car. It keeps impurities and dust out of the air in the engine which results in smoother combustion. If the airflow is not properly maintained the engine will have trouble starting, running, or acceleration.
